摘要
为解决煤矿电力系统中大功率设备的启停、电力系统故障短路、开关设备和变频设备启停,所产生的浪涌,分析了长方体壳体屏蔽衰减特性,以KBZ-400/1140(660)矿用隔爆型真空馈电开关的隔爆外壳为例,研究了隔爆外壳的屏蔽特性。研究结果表明,屏蔽外壳对于浪涌电磁辐射具有很强的屏蔽作用。研究结果为煤矿井下电磁兼容标准制定,和矿用电工电子产品设计提供依据。
In mine power supply network, the start-stop or short circuit fault of high power equipment, and the operation of power supply equipment and frequency conversion equipment will lead to the surge. In the paper the shielding effectiveness of cuboid flameproof enclosure was researched, taking KBZ-400/1140(660) mining flameproof vacuum feed switch' s flameproof enclosure as an example. The result shows that the flameproof enclosure has strong shielding action to electromagnetic radiation induced by surge. The research results are of guide significance for formulating electromagnetic compatibility standard and designing electric products used in mine.
